Washing the face every day lays the groundwork for a successful beauty regimen. Over time, pores collect impurities, oil, and bacteria, that, when ignored, often result in blemishes, lack of radiance, and skin issues. Proper washing gets rid of these impurities, making sure a clean facial area. Yet, one must to choose a mild face wash tailored to individual concerns to prevent dehydration. Harsh products may strip essential moisture, causing sensitivity. Those with delicate skin should opt for dermatologist-recommended products. Those with excess sebum may prefer gel-based washes that provide balance without overcompensating. Nourishing face washes work best for dehydrated skin, maintaining softness without tightness.
Following cleansing, moisturizing is a must in any skincare routine. Moisturizers serve to replenish hydration, preventing flakiness and irritation.
